Reduces condensation

Condensation occurs naturally when water vapour cools and turns into liquid. This can occur on windows, furniture and other surfaces in your home. Condensation is caused by many factors, including humidity levels and inadequate ventilation. A double-glazed window can reduce condensation by adding an extra layer of insulation to your home and decreasing temperatures fluctuations.

If you notice condensation on your windows then it's time to replace the windows. This is especially true if you notice cracks, holes or scratches in the glass. Cracks and holes may be a sign that the sealant between glass panes has worn away and can affect the efficiency of double glazing.

It is important to take action immediately if you notice your windows turning cloudy. This can affect the look of your home and reduce your view of the outside world. This could also be a sign that your windows aren't as energy-efficient as they should be.

You can fix a misty glass in a variety of ways, including by using a humidifier and opening your windows for a few minutes each day. Alternatively, you can use a specific drying agent that is injected or pumped into the gap between the windows.

Choose a double-glazing provider that is FENSA-certified (Fenestration Self-Assessment Scheme) or GGF-certified (Glass and Glazing Federation). This means that they have been evaluated by the independent body to ensure they comply with the latest industry standards and regulations. They are also equipped to offer you a free consumer advice line and a complaints procedure.
